Tags: meme, ancient, astronauts, theorize
Tags: funny, arrival, foretold, ancient, murals
Tags: funny, ancient, greeks, figured, portal, technology
Tags: funny, meanwhile, ancient, rome
Tags: funny, ancient, egyptians
Tags: funny, ancient, complaints, source
Tags: funny, world, produced, ancient, grease
Tags: funny, ancient, aliens